Biomarker Discovery and Validation: Identifying potential biomarkers through research, validating their clinical utility, and ensuring reproducibility across studies.
Research and Data Analysis: Conducting laboratory experiments, analyzing high-throughput biological data, and interpreting findings.
Collaboration with Clinical Teams: Working with clinicians and researchers to design and implement biomarker-related studies, including patient sample collection and data interpretation.
Technology Development: Developing and optimizing assays or platforms (e.g., ELISA, PCR, NGS) for biomarker detection and quantification.
Regulatory Compliance: Ensuring compliance with regulatory guidelines for biomarker qualification, and preparing documentation for submission to regulatory bodies (e.g., FDA, EMA).
Cross-functional Collaboration: Collaborating with drug development, diagnostics, and R&D teams to integrate biomarkers into preclinical and clinical programs.
Publication and Reporting: Publishing results in peer-reviewed journals, presenting at scientific conferences, and reporting to stakeholders.
Quality Control and Assurance: Monitoring the integrity of data and maintaining rigorous quality control procedures in biomarker analysis.
Translational Research: Bridging basic research with clinical applications, ensuring biomarkers can be translated into clinical diagnostics or therapeutic decision-making.
Budget and Resource Management: Managing research budgets, ensuring the efficient use of resources, and aligning projects with organizational goals.
